You might be wondering why pebbles have been laid? Well, the answer is two-fold. In the first instance, they provide a solid foundation for the decking boards to sit on top of, but the extra function is drainage!
When rain falls, the water needs to be able to run through the gaps between the decking boards and drain away quickly to prevent the wood from rotting. Plus, with borders close by, drainage is even more vital.
